Claire’s shuts standalone store network in UK and Ireland
Claire’s has closed all 154 of its standalone stores in the UK and Ireland, according to the latest reports. The retailer’s withdrawal from its physical standalone locations marks a major change for the accessories chain in both markets.
Reports indicate that around 1,300 jobs are affected by the closures. The development represents a significant blow for retail workers and adds to the pressure facing bricks-and-mortar chains operating across the UK and Ireland.
The company’s standalone stores have now stopped trading, based on early coverage of the announcement. No further operational details were included in the source summary, and it remains unclear what the next steps will be for staff, customers or any remaining parts of the business in the region.
